Go to the international airport (GIG), terminal 1, floor 3. Follow the signs to the immigration office. Tell them you want to renew and they'll direct you to the correct line.
After filing out a form, they give you an invoice and you go to the bank on the same floor to pay the fee (67 R$). Then go back to the office and hopefully you'll visa will be ready. That's it.
I didn't need a credit card, proof of ongoing travel, or bank statements... only my passport and the money.
Note that you get three months extra based on when you go. So if your initial stamps expires January 22 and you go to renew on January 20, you'll get a stamp until April 20. So just wait until the last day.
You can stay in brazil for six months and then you have to leave for six months. Border runs don't work. If you overstay then you simply pay a fine. I think it runs about 100-200 R$ per month overstay but I'm not certain.
